Adani Group rolls out ‘Arthik Azadi’ to champion women’s financial freedom

Adani Group’s Corporate Brand Custodian (CBC) Digital team has unveiled Arthik Azadi, a three-film series for the Adani Foundation that spotlights the everyday freedom unlocked through financial independence.

Setting the tone for the series, Dr Priti G Adani, Chairperson, Adani Foundation, said, “A woman empowered is India empowered. If we truly want progress that matters, the fulfilment of women’s potential is not optional. It is non-negotiable.”

For 29 years, the Foundation, the social and development arm of the Adani Group, has strengthened women’s agency through education, health, livelihoods, climate action and community development. Today the non-profit reaches 9.6 million people, including two million women across 7,000+ villages in 22 states.
